Task: Write an essay on the topic "Is society becoming more or less responsive to public opinion?". Your essay should be written in at least 250 words and take a clear position on the issue. Here is a suggested answer to guide you:


In recent years, it can be argued that society has become both more and less responsive to public opinion, depending on various factors such as advances in technology and shifts in political power. While this complex relationship between societal responsiveness and public opinion may seem contradictory at first glance, a closer examination of the matter reveals a nuanced understanding of the current state of society.

On one hand, the rise of social media has given the general public an unprecedented platform to voice their opinions and share their thoughts with a wide audience. As a result, individuals have become more empowered than ever before to influence societal change and hold those in power accountable for their actions. This heightened visibility of public opinion has undoubtedly led to increased responsiveness from certain sectors of society, such as the media, which now frequently report on trending topics and popular concerns raised by the general public.

On the other hand, however, there are also instances where societal responsiveness appears to be waning. In particular, powerful institutions and political bodies may prioritize their own interests over those of the public, particularly in times of crisis or when faced with significant opposition. Furthermore, the influence of special interest groups, lobbying, and corruption can distort the true will of the people, thereby diminishing the responsiveness of society to public opinion.

In conclusion, while advances in technology have given individuals a louder voice in shaping societal discourse, there are still significant barriers that prevent society from being entirely responsive to public opinion. As such, it can be argued that society's responsiveness to public opinion is both increasing and decreasing, with the ultimate impact of this complex relationship remaining uncertain.
